人工智能自学网站推荐
一、综合学习平台
网站名称 | 简介 | 特点 |
Coursera | 与多所大学和机构合作,提供大量人工智能相关课程。 | 课程种类丰富,涵盖基础到高级知识;有专业证书项目,助力职业发展。 |
edX | 由哈佛大学和麻省理工学院创立,汇聚全球高校课程资源。 | 课程质量高,部分课程提供认证证书;学习社区活跃,便于交流讨论。 |
二、专业技术社区
网站名称 | 简介 | 特点 |
Stack Overflow | 面向编程问题的专业问答社区,涉及众多技术领域。 | 问题解答及时且专业,可快速解决技术难题;积累大量代码示例,方便参考学习。 |
GitHub | 全球最大的开源代码托管平台,众多 AI 项目在此开源。 | 能直接参与开源项目,提升实践能力;学习优秀项目的代码架构和实现思路。 |
三、数据资源平台
网站名称 | 简介 | 特点 |
Kaggle | 提供海量数据集和数据分析竞赛平台。 | 数据丰富多样,可用于实践项目和算法验证;通过竞赛锻炼实战能力,了解行业前沿应用。 |
UCI 机器学习库 | 拥有大量分类、回归等各类机器学习数据集。 | 数据集经过整理和标注,方便使用;适用于学术研究和算法测试。 |
四、在线教程与博客
网站名称 | 简介 | 特点 |
Towards Data Science | 专注于数据科学领域的博客平台,有大量优质教程。 | 内容涵盖面广,包括理论讲解和案例分析;紧跟行业动态,分享最新研究成果和应用案例。 |
Medium(AI 板块) | 综合性的写作平台,有众多关于人工智能的文章和教程。 | 作者众多,观点多元;文章深度和广度兼具,适合不同层次学习者。 |
相关问题与解答
解答:大部分网站的基础课程和资源是免费的,但一些高级课程、认证证书或特定服务可能需要付费,Coursera 的部分专业证书课程需要支付费用才能获得证书,而 Kaggle 的基本数据集和竞赛参与是免费的。
问题二:如何根据自己的水平选择合适的网站开始学习?
解答:如果是零基础初学者,可以先从综合性学习平台如 Coursera 或 edX 的基础课程入手,系统学习人工智能的基本概念和知识框架,有了一定基础后,可以参与 Stack Overflow 的技术交流,在 GitHub 上尝试参与简单开源项目,利用 Kaggle 进行初步的实践操作,同时阅读 Towards Data Science 等平台上的进阶教程来深化理解,随着水平的进一步提高,再根据自身兴趣和职业方向深入探索各网站的高级资源和专业内容。